Stated no one is in favor of leaving the Del Monte in its current condition; urged final passage of the ordinances: Michael McDonough, Chamber of Commerce. Expressed support for the project: John Piziali, Alameda. Expressed support for the Planning Board and staff; urged moving forward: Nick Cabral, Alameda. Stated the choice is restoration or dilapidation; those opposed have not offered alternatives; a decision should be made tonight; that he is in favor the project: Art Lenhardt, Alameda. Stated that she likes the project, but a decision should not be made tonight; expressed concern over the holding the hearing at the last meeting; stated greater discussion is needed: Jane Sullwold, Alameda. Expressed concern over the plan not being complete; outlined omissions: Ken Peterson, Alameda. Expressed support for the project, which is good for the neighborhood and schools: Kevin Gorham, Encinal High School Principal and Alameda resident. Stated the project would provide a needed housing supply: Kari Thompson, Chamber of Commerce and Alameda resident. Stated the area has always been tremendously underutilized; the plans are thoughtful and well designed; Alameda needs more housing; urged approval: Charles Rogerson, Alameda. Urged the decision be deferred: Red Wetherill, Alameda. Provided an example of a development causing problems; stated parking is crucial; expressed her opposition to the project: Virginia Bergstrom, Alameda. Stated problems need to be addressed; voting tonight would tarnish a good project: Adam Gillitt, Alameda. Urged approval of the project; outlined benefits: Karen Bey, Alameda. Expressed concern over the Plan's readiness: Former Councilmember Doug deHaan. Discussed an article which quoted the Mayor; stated although development brings in money, costs need to be addressed, such as traffic: Alan Mitchum, Alameda.
